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Paper Feel Ipad Screen Protectors

Surface Texture Friction

The primary reason to choose these protectors is the tactile resistance they add to your stylus. You want a surface that mimics the light drag of a graphite pencil on high-quality paper. Too much friction feels like sandpaper and will destroy your pen tip, while too little defeats the purpose of buying one in the first place.

Screen Clarity Trade-off

Adding a matte layer inevitably introduces a slight grain to your display. This haze acts like a fine dusting of fog on a window, which can soften the sharpness of your Retina screen. Prioritize models that claim high light transmission if you use your iPad for color-critical design work.

Tip Wear and Tear

The physical friction required to create that "paper" sensation acts like a fine-grit file on your Apple Pencil tip. You will notice your nibs wearing down much faster than on bare glass. Expect to replace your stylus tips more frequently, or consider using a metal-tipped stylus to minimize the degradation.

Installation Precision

Applying a screen protector is like performing surgery in a dusty room. Look for kits that include alignment frames or hinges to ensure the film sits perfectly centered on your screen. A bubble-free application is essential, as trapped air pockets under a matte surface are far more distracting than they are on clear glass.

Durability and Maintenance

Matte surfaces are prone to catching oils and fingerprints more aggressively than glossy protectors. Choose a brand that specifies an oleophobic coating to make cleaning easier. Keep a microfiber cloth nearby, as you will need it to wipe away the smudges that accumulate during a long drawing session.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will these protectors scratch my iPad screen over time?

No, these films are designed to act as a sacrificial barrier. They protect your actual display from scratches caused by debris or heavy stylus pressure. You should have no concerns about the film damaging the glass underneath.

Do these protectors affect touch sensitivity?

Modern versions are thin enough that they do not interfere with multi-touch gestures or taps. You might notice a very minor change in how your finger glides across the surface, but your iPad will still respond accurately to your input.

Can I use these with a protective case?

Most of these protectors are designed with case-friendly edges. They stop just short of the very edge of the glass to prevent your case from lifting the film. Double-check your case fit if you use a heavy-duty model with a thick bezel.

How often should I replace the film?

You should swap the protector once the surface friction wears down or the film becomes heavily scratched. Many heavy users replace them every six to twelve months. If you notice the surface feeling smooth and slippery, the paper-like effect has faded.

Are these easy to remove if I change my mind?

They are simple to peel off whenever you choose. Start at one corner and pull slowly to avoid snapping the film. Any residual adhesive can be cleaned off with a damp cloth or a standard screen cleaner, leaving your original glass perfectly clean.
